Any NRI can apply for a PAN by submitting Form No. 49A along with the required documents and fees to a PAN application centre such as UTIITSL or Protean (formerly NSDL eGov).
When you submit your PAN Card application online/offline, you are issued a unique acknowledgment number. This number is similar to tracking numbers generated when you shop on an online marketplace.
If a PAN card is lost, individuals do not need to obtain a new PAN. Instead, they can apply for a duplicate PAN card through the income tax department.
